Manila, Philippines – The 2nd run of Asset Performance Management – Leadership, Engineering, ADvantage (APM LEAD) Conference and Exhibition 2024 is set to take place from July 3 to July 5, 2024, at the Citadines Bay City Manila. This premier event, themed “Sustainable Futures,” will bring together top professionals and thought leaders from diverse industries to discuss the latest sustainable trends and innovations in physical asset performance management.

This year’s conference boasts an impressive array of speakers, featuring global sustainability experts, influential policymakers, and renowned industry leaders. Notable speakers include representatives from diverse sectors such as energy, oil and gas, petrochemical, manufacturing, and technology solutions. Key speakers include representatives from the Department of Public Works and Highways, Aboitiz Power, Light Rail Manila Corporation, Chevron, Shell Philippines, Petron Corporation, San Miguel Corporation, and tech giants like SAP and Hexagon EAM. Their insights will be crucial in exploring collaborative efforts between businesses and governments to create a sustainable future, offering case studies and best practices from their respective industries

Engaging Sessions and Topics

Attendees will have the opportunity to delve into a wide range of topics through keynote speeches, panel discussions, and interactive workshops. Key plenary session topics include:

  1. Policy, Partnerships, and Performance: Collaborative Frameworks for SDG Progress: Exploring how businesses and governments can work together to advance sustainable development goals (SDGs).
  2. Enhancing Sustainable Asset Management Through Big Data: Discussing the role of big data in improving sustainable asset management practices.
  3. Circular Economy and Waste Minimization in Asset Management: Techniques and strategies for minimizing waste through sustainable production and consumption.
  4. Enhancing Asset Reliability to Foster Industry Innovation and Infrastructure (SDG 9): Approaches to improving asset reliability to support innovation and infrastructure development.
  5. Socioeconomic Inclusion in Asset Management Strategies (SDG 10): Addressing the importance of including diverse socioeconomic groups in asset management strategies to promote equality and inclusion.

These sessions are designed to provide practical knowledge and inspire actionable strategies for implementing sustainable practices in various sectors.
